Acts 7 — Context

10

And made him free from all his troubles, and gave him wisdom and the approval of Pharaoh, king of Egypt, who made him ruler over Egypt and all his house.

11

Now there was no food to be had in all Egypt and Canaan, and there was great trouble: and our fathers were not able to get food.

12

But Jacob, hearing that there was grain in Egypt, sent out our fathers the first time.

13

And the second time his brothers had a meeting with Joseph, and Pharaoh had knowledge of Joseph's family.

14

Then Joseph sent for Jacob his father and all his family, seventy-five persons.

15

And Jacob went down to Egypt, and came to his end there, and so did our fathers;

16

And they were taken over to Shechem, and put to rest in the place which Abraham got for a price in silver from the sons of Hamor in Shechem.

Who wrote Acts?
Acts is traditionally attributed to Luke. It was written c. AD 62–64.
What is the book of Acts about?
Acts is the sequel to Luke's Gospel — the story of how the message of the risen Jesus moved out from Jerusalem to Judea, Samaria, and the ends of the earth. Through Peter, Paul, and many ordinary believers, the Holy Spirit builds the early church across the Roman world.
